Identifying Different Types of Cleaning Services
The variety of cleaning services available can be overwhelming. They can generally be categorized into two main types: residential and commercial cleaning services.
- Residential Cleaning Services: These services are tailored for homes and apartments. They often include routine cleaning tasks such as dusting, vacuuming, mopping, and bathroom sanitation. Some residential services also offer specialized deep cleaning, move-in/move-out cleaning, and post-renovation cleaning.
- Commercial Cleaning Services: These services cater to businesses and typically involve the cleaning of offices, retail spaces, and other commercial properties. The scope of work may include sanitizing offices, cleaning carpets, window washing, and floor maintenance.
Assessing Your Home’s Unique Cleaning Requirements
Each home has its unique cleaning requirements based on factors such as size, the number of occupants, lifestyle, and presence of pets. Assessing these needs can help determine the frequency of cleaning required and identify specific areas that need more attention. For example, households with pets may require more frequent vacuuming and deep cleaning to manage hair and dander.
Setting Your Cleaning Budget
Your budget will play a critical role in determining the type of cleaning services you can afford. Typical pricing models for Cleaning service include hourly rates, flat fees, or subscription services, where a fee is paid for regular cleanings. It is advisable to obtain estimates from a few different providers to find a balance between your budget and the quality of service.
How to Find Reputable Cleaning Service Providers
Finding a trustworthy cleaning service is crucial for both your peace of mind and the integrity of your home. The following strategies can help you identify reputable providers.
Researching Local Cleaning Service Options
Start by researching cleaning services available in your local area. Online directories, social media, and local community boards can provide valuable leads. Be sure to look for companies that have a strong online presence and a history of positive customer experiences.
Evaluating Customer Reviews and Testimonials
One of the most effective ways to gauge the quality of a cleaning service is to read customer reviews and testimonials. Look for reviews on independent platforms, as this will give you a balanced view of the service’s strengths and weaknesses. Pay particular attention to recurring comments about reliability, thoroughness, and customer service.
Contacting References for Insight
If you’re considering a specific cleaning service, don’t hesitate to request references. Speaking directly to past clients can provide insights into the company’s work ethic, reliability, and overall performance. Ask specific questions to get a better understanding of what you can expect.
Questions to Ask Your Potential Cleaning Service
When you have narrowed down your options, it’s time to communicate with potential cleaning services. Asking the right questions can save you time and money while ensuring you get the quality you need.
Inquiring About Cleaning Products and Methods
Understanding the cleaning products and methods used is essential, especially if you have allergies or sensitivities. Inquire whether the service uses eco-friendly or green cleaning products, as these can be safer for both your family and the environment.
Understanding Service Agreements and Policies
Be sure to clarify any service agreements and policies before committing to a cleaning service. This includes details on cancellation policies, service guarantees, and the procedures in place for addressing complaints or unsatisfactory service.
Clarifying Pricing Structures and Payment Options
Different cleaning services may have varied pricing structures. Ensure you understand how much you will be paying, what the pricing covers, and the payment methods available. Being clear about these details upfront can help avoid unexpected expenses later.
